BeenSeen is a free dress-up game that runs in your browser. The idea behind it is simple: fashion is more fun when someone actually sees it. You create a model, dress them up from a catalog of thousands of clothing items, and post your looks to a community that votes, comments and trades.
Style your own model
Every player gets a model to customize. You pick the body type and skin tone, and your wardrobe grows as you play. The clothes range from everyday streetwear to seasonal collections and rare animated pieces. Items also come in rarity tiers, so putting together a standout look takes some taste and a bit of collecting.
An economy run by players
The game runs on BeanBucks 🫘. That's the in-game currency, and you earn it by playing. No purchase needed. You can spend it in the shop, but the fun really starts when you go deeper: trade items directly with other players, bid on rare pieces in the auction house, and hunt down that one item your look is missing. Some players even design their own clothes and sell them in the store.
A social feed for fashion
The heart of BeenSeen is the social feed. Post your outfit of the day, join themed challenges, react to what other players are wearing, make some friends. There are also Outfit of the Day contests where everyone styles a look around a theme and the community votes. Winning one feels genuinely good.
Minigames and more
Between styling sessions you can play minigames like Block Buster, Bubble Shooter, Fashion Showdown and even a little stock market. They all pay out BeanBucks and XP. Leveling up unlocks rewards, and daily tasks keep the money coming in.
Free to play, in your browser
No download, no install. Creating an account takes less than a minute and everything in the game can be earned by playing. There is an optional membership with perks like more saved looks and monthly gems, but the full game is open to everyone.
